How To Prepare A Project For Finite Element Analysis
Finite element analysis allows you to assess how products, structures, and systems will likely work in real-world conditions. You need to do more than hand a project to an FEA consulting firm, though. Clients must prepare their projects by doing these five things.
Determining the Necessary Scale
Some FEA services projects work at very large scales. If a civil engineer is trying to determine how a bridge will perform during a hurricane, the analysis isn't likely to look at tiny elements. Conversely, a product designer who is trying to figure out when a pin in a machine will snap may need to get very granular.
You should right-side the scale of the analysis. Doing a fine analysis of a large object like a dam, for example, may be an unnecessary use of processing time. You could probably better invest those compute cycles in running more simulations.
Identify Prior Understandings
Generally, FEA involves analysis based on well-established data. For example, many buildings have suffered damage during earthquakes worldwide. Consequently, an analyst can make many assumptions about how numerous kinds of materials will perform.
There are rare cases, though, where someone may need to analyze a poorly-understood material or type of system. In these instances, you may need to invest some simulation time in trying to sort out performance characteristics. Likewise, you may need to go back and forth between FEA and real-world testing to fine-tune the analysis.
Before you start a project, try to itemize what you do or don't know well about the problem. An FEA consulting engineer can apply their knowledge to determine the best approach.
Consider Many Scenarios
Folks involved with projects often focus on narrow cases where things might fail. However, you should consider a broad range of possibilities. If you're trying to assess how well a bolt will perform under heat stress, you should consider many different starting conditions from cold to hot. Likewise, you might need to analyze the bolt's performance in the water, coastal air, and even high pollution.
Ideate as many scenarios as possible. Remember, an improbable scenario is not the same as an impossible one.
Plan Verification Processes
An FEA services firm can't guarantee their results will match the ones you'll see in the real world. FEA is not a substitute for real-world testing. When you're starting FEA, also begin thinking about how you're going to practically verify whatever results you might uncover.
Be Persistent
Prepare to iterate the process of analysis and real-world testing if there is a divergence. Keep iterating until you arrive at an explanation.
